Phantom Pain (Shanks x GN!reader)

👑 CW: angst, hurt/comfort, thoughts of limb loss, phantom pain

👑 Brief description: late at night reader finds Shanks in the kitchen unable to sleep from a phantom pain in the arm he’s lost years ago

Enjoy!

In the middle of the night, you wake up. Something wakes you up.

You lie as if thrown ashore, your head half-dipped in sleep still washing over your mind in a low tide. Your senses are heightened, however, drowsy conscious having given reign to instinct. 

You strain your ears. No screams, no battle cries, no rowdy, drunken shouts. No clash of swords, no bullets flying into wood and flesh. So, nothing either dangerous or urgent. What, then?

It could‘ve been a single sound that died as soon as it woke you, a simple balance. But you know better, and you know that this isn’t the reason. 

Not without difficulty, you push yourself up on your elbows. You sway, hit with a wave of sleep intent on drowning you in unconsciousness; how dare something pull you from its murky depths.

You roll over the edge of the bed and hit the floor with a shoulder and a pained oof. So much for trying to clear your head faster.

From that position you turn your head towards the door to see light coming from the gap between the exit and the floor. Not bright, quite dim, though still a light peering in as if it was what rose you from your slumber, sheepish in its urgency but firm in its concern, calling gently for you to come resolve the problem you are yet to learn of; come and turn the light off, let it sleep again.

Your shoulder throbs; your head aches with demand for rest. You ignore them both and stand up. Move for the door and the light under it like an ship drawn by the beam of a lighthouse.

The door creakes under the weight you push onto its knob. In your current state you forget to mind the still silence of the night.

As it turns out, the light is coming from the kitchen, the door to which has been left ajar. One might have thought at first that was quite mindless and thoughtless, as for the ship is filled with people docking at the harbour of the night for rest. However, it has been meant as something opposite, as thus no creak will rise if the one in the kitchen decides to join his crewmates. 

Your bare feet make no sound as you move along the corridor, a palm on the wall for support. Nothing this night makes a sound, the world completely devoid of a major sense. This proves that something else indeed has woken you up. A sixth sense. A seventh, perhaps, even. 

Your hand rests on the doorframe and you peer inside.

“Ah, hello, angel. What’re you doing up so late?“

You squint. Droplets of sleep fall from your lashes and disappear between the creaks of wood under your feet. A rasp of a voice and a red head of hair like bright flags on a beach warning you of a storm already raging.

As your eyes adjust to the light, the room tells you more than the person in front of you would. A bottle squeezed in a white-knuckled grip; a face, pale and untrimmed of its stubble; a smile like a string pulled tight, a pop resonating through your mind the longer you look at it, about to snap. 

You don‘t give Shanks an answer; you simply take an unoccupied chair, put it down behind his own, rest the weight of your body on it and your temple on Shank’s shoulder.

His back is tight, his neck also, his whole body. Also a string ready to snap. Your nose finds a point of bare skin above the collar of his shirt and presses gently in. Perhaps, its cold will distract his body from the pain.

Shanks starts to shiver. You exhale, close your eyes and move your head to now press your forehead to the same point.

Your shoulder throbs. You wonder if the ache you feel is his or yours. You wonder how often it hurts, the arm that’s no longer there. How often and how much. For how much longer will it?

“Thank you, angel. Sorry I woke you up.”

It’s ok, your body answers for you as you sink under the surface of unconsciousness.

The redhead pirates find you in the morning, both asleep at the kitchen table, a bottle in Shanks’ hand, half-full.
